Have spent the last few months screwing around w/ how I was going to go about getting forks dialed in by what I could afford. Been on every thread for at least a 1/2 dozen forums getting everyones take on it. Called a few manuf. and spoke to techs like Race Tech, Ikon, SSA, Progressive, and a few more. Spoke w/ Mike from 650Central a few times and I've come to the conclusion he actually think the Mintons Mod (the drilling) is stupid and should only be done if at all when using emulators. Hes been meaning to remove that sheet for awhile. I did quit messing around thinking I could get good results just drilling stock dampers. There is a guy (Donny) in town here that has had a suspension shop for yrs. (RC Suspension) He recently got called to help support class of KTM at Supercross. Anyway he told me I might be able to get some results w/ just the drilling but it will take forever to get it right making the adjustment. he said where you drill was critical. He said he could help me w/ that but I just ended up getting the RT emulators and drilled to their specs. They make it clear not to do any drilling up top for rebound.
